Understanding the Unseen Hazards in Your Carpets

Carpets, commonly regarded as a warm complement to interior design, can harbor a array of hidden dangers that pose health risks. Under their soft fibers lies a breeding ground for allergens, dust mites, and bacteria, which can cause respiratory issues and allergies in sensitive individuals. Mold can also grow in damp conditions, releasing spores that contaminate indoor air quality. Furthermore, pet dander and hair collect within the carpet, worsening allergy symptoms for many households. The presence of chemical residues from previous cleaning agents or environmental pollutants further complicates the situation, as they may result in long-term health concerns. As children and pets frequently come into contact with carpets, the risk of exposure to these hidden threats escalates. Understanding the potential dangers lurking within carpets emphasizes the importance of regular, thorough cleaning to ensure a healthier living environment for all inhabitants.

What's the Ideal Frequency for Scheduling Professional Cleaning?

How regularly should property owners plan for scheduling professional carpet cleaning to copyright a healthy living environment? Industry experts recommend that households with low foot traffic maintain their carpets at least once per year. Nonetheless, families with children, pets, or high foot traffic may require scheduling cleanings every six months or even quarterly. The frequency can also rely on the type of carpet and its fibers, as some materials may demand more frequent maintenance to sustain their visual quality and life expectancy.

For those with allergies, increased cleaning is encouraged to decrease dust, allergens, and pollutants that can build up in carpets. Moreover, seasonal changes can impact cleaning needs, particularly during periods of elevated outdoor activity. Homeowners should evaluate their unique circumstances, including lifestyle and carpet condition, to determine an appropriate cleaning schedule. Regular professional cleaning not only enhances carpet longevity but also fosters a cleaner home environment.

Getting Rid of Odors and Stains Successfully

Stains and odors can greatly detract from a home's look and livability, making effective removal essential for preserving a welcoming environment. Over time, spills, pet accidents, and general wear can lead to stubborn stains and lingering smells that standard cleaning supplies frequently cannot remove. Professional carpet cleaning services use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ions designed to target these issues more effectively than conventional methods.

For example, hot water extraction penetrates deeply into carpet fibers, dislodging dirt and stains while concurrently removing odors at their origin. Furthermore, skilled professionals have the knowledge to determine the correct treatment for different kinds of stains, including wine, ink, or grease. This precise method not only eliminates visible blemishes but also aids in preventing subsequent damage to the carpet. By committing to professional cleaning, homeowners can rejuvenate their carpets, securing a fresh, sanitary space that elevates both visual appeal and comfort.

Selecting the Right Carpet Cleaning Provider

Selecting the appropriate carpet cleaning service can greatly impact the effectiveness of stain and odor removal efforts. To guarantee ideal results, homeowners should consider several key factors. First, it is essential to assess the company’s reputation. Online reviews and testimonials provide insight into past customer experiences and satisfaction levels. Additionally, evaluating the range of services offered is vital. Some companies specialize in specific cleaning methods, such as steam cleaning or dry cleaning, which may be more suitable for particular carpet types.

Licensing and insurance are also important considerations; a reputable service should have proper certifications and coverage to shield both the client and their property. Finally, obtaining quotes from multiple companies can help homeowners make well-informed decisions based on budget and expected outcomes. By carefully considering these elements, property owners can identify a carpet cleaning service that meets their needs and contributes to a cleaner home environment.

How Much Time Does Carpet Drying Take After Cleaning?

Generally, carpets take between 6 to 12 hours to fully dry after cleaning, depending on factors such as humidity, air flow, and the cleaning method applied. Ideal drying can boost the lifespan and hygiene of the carpet.
